Summary of Wastewater Systems
Wastewater systems are crucial facilities components that play a crucial role in taking care of pre-owned water from residential, industrial, and farming resources. These systems are developed to collect, transportation, reward, and discharge wastewater, making certain that it is processed efficiently prior to re-entering the setting. The primary elements of a wastewater system consist of collection networks, treatment centers, and discharge mechanisms.
Collection networks normally contain a series of pipelines and pumping terminals that gather wastewater from different resources and direct it to treatment centers. Treatment facilities are furnished with advanced innovations that get rid of microorganisms and toxins, transforming polluted water right into a cleaner state ideal for launch or reuse. This process often entails several stages, consisting of initial, key, second, and often tertiary therapy, each made to address particular pollutants.
The last of a wastewater system involves the secure discharge or recycling of cured water, which can be gone back to all-natural water bodies or repurposed for watering and commercial procedures. By effectively managing wastewater, these systems not only safeguard public health and wellness and the atmosphere but likewise add to the lasting use water resources, making them crucial in modern-day facilities.
Ecological Influences of Poor Monitoring
The effects of poor wastewater management can be extensive, causing considerable environmental degradation. Inadequately taken care of wastewater systems usually cause the contamination of regional water bodies, introducing harmful toxins such as heavy metals, virus, and nutrients. This contamination can interrupt water communities, leading to lowered biodiversity and the decrease of sensitive species.
Moreover, without treatment or inadequately dealt with wastewater can add to eutrophication, a process where excess nutrients promote algal flowers. These blooms diminish oxygen levels in the water, developing dead zones that are unwelcoming to most marine life. In addition, the presence of virus in neglected wastewater poses severe public health threats, potentially leading to waterborne diseases that influence both human and animal populations.
Dirt contamination is another essential issue, as leachate from poorly handled wastewater can penetrate groundwater supplies, endangering drinking water top quality. The cumulative impacts of these ecological impacts expand past prompt ecological repercussions, contributing to long-lasting challenges such as environment adjustment and resource shortage. Consequently, understanding and dealing with the ramifications of poor wastewater management is important for advertising environmental sustainability and guaranteeing the wellness of communities and communities alike.

Innovative Technologies in Wastewater Therapy
Improvements in innovative modern technologies are reinventing wastewater treatment processes, straightening with the goals of sustainability and efficiency. These technologies encompass a series of techniques created to improve the therapy procedure while lessening ecological impact. One remarkable advancement is the execution of membrane bioreactors (MBRs), which integrate organic therapy with membrane filtering, causing see top notch effluent and reduced energy intake.
In addition, the development of decentralized therapy systems offers adaptable services for areas, decreasing the demand for comprehensive framework and promoting source recovery with nutrient recycling. These technologies not only boost treatment effectiveness yet also contribute to a round economy by recouping valuable resources from wastewater. As the market proceeds to develop, accepting these cutting-edge technologies will play a crucial role in accomplishing ecological sustainability and making certain a trustworthy wastewater management system for future generations.
